出版時(shí)間:2008-4 出版社:電子工業(yè)出版社 作者:畢曉普 頁數(shù):436 譯者:喬瑞萍
Tag標(biāo)簽:無
內(nèi)容概要
成千上萬的工程師、科學(xué)家和技術(shù)人員都在使用LabVIEW來創(chuàng)建應(yīng)用程序所需要的解決方案。LabVIEW是一種革命性的圖形編程開發(fā)環(huán)境,以G編程語言為基礎(chǔ),用于數(shù)據(jù)采集、控制、數(shù)據(jù)分析以及數(shù)據(jù)顯示?! ”緯槍abVIEW,循序漸進(jìn)地介紹了虛擬儀器設(shè)計(jì)的主旨,以及圖形化編程語言的原理、方法和應(yīng)用技術(shù)。全書共分11章,另有附錄A、B,介紹了LabVIEW的基礎(chǔ)知識、虛擬儀器的組成、MathScript技術(shù)、編輯和調(diào)試虛擬儀器、重用代碼的重要性、如何創(chuàng)建圖標(biāo)/連接器。也講述了結(jié)構(gòu)、數(shù)組和簇、圖表和圖形、數(shù)據(jù)采集、字符串和文件I/O、儀器控制、分析及應(yīng)用示例等?! ”緯勺鳛榇?、中專院校通信、測控等相關(guān)專業(yè)的教材或教學(xué)參考書,也可作為相關(guān)工程技術(shù)人員設(shè)計(jì)開發(fā)儀器或自動(dòng)測試系統(tǒng)的技術(shù)參考書。
書籍目錄
第1章 LabVlEW入門 1.1 系統(tǒng)配置要求 1.2 安裝LabVIEW學(xué)習(xí)版 1.3 LabVIEW環(huán)境 1.4 啟動(dòng)畫面 1.5 前面板和框圖窗口 1.6 快捷菜單 1.7 下拉菜單 1.8 選項(xiàng)板 1.9 打開、加載和保存VI 1.10 LabVIEW幫助選項(xiàng) 1.11 搭積木:脈寬調(diào)制 1.12 課后閱讀:用LabVIEW實(shí)現(xiàn)遙控挖掘 1.13 小結(jié)第2章 虛擬儀器 2.1 什么是虛擬儀器 2.2 幾個(gè)工作示例 2.3 前面板 2.4 框圖 2.5 創(chuàng)建第一個(gè)VI 2.6 數(shù)據(jù)流編程 2.7 使用Express VI構(gòu)建VI 2.8 搭積木:脈寬調(diào)制 2.9 課后閱讀:LabVlEW自動(dòng)化腦電圖實(shí)驗(yàn) 2.10 小結(jié)第3章 MathScript 3.1 什么是MathScript 3.2 訪問MathScript交互式窗口 3.3 MathScript幫助 3.4 語法 3.5 自定義函數(shù)并生成腳本 3.6 數(shù)據(jù)文件的保存、加載和導(dǎo)出 3.7 MathScript節(jié)點(diǎn) 3.8 MathScript的應(yīng)用 3.9 搭積木:脈寬調(diào)制 3.10 課后閱讀:為新一代的游戲產(chǎn)品設(shè)計(jì)產(chǎn)品檢測系統(tǒng) 3.11 小結(jié)第4章 編輯和調(diào)試虛擬儀器 4.1 編輯技術(shù) 4.2 調(diào)試技術(shù) 4.3 快捷鍵 4.4 搭積木:脈寬調(diào)制 4.5 課后閱讀:LabVIEW協(xié)助下一代微處理器的制造過程 4.6 小結(jié)第5章 子VI 5.1 什么是子VI 5.2 基本知識回顧 5.3 編輯圖標(biāo)和連接器 5.4 幫助窗口 5.5 將VI用做子VI 5.6 從選定內(nèi)容創(chuàng)建子VI 5.7 保存子VI 5.8 VI層次窗口 5.9 搭積木:脈寬調(diào)制 5.10 課后閱讀:LabVIEW Real-Time在生物圈中的應(yīng)用 5.11 小結(jié)第6章 結(jié)構(gòu) 6.1 For循環(huán) 6.2 While循環(huán) 6.3 移位寄存器和反饋節(jié)點(diǎn) 6.4 Case結(jié)構(gòu) 6.5 單層順序結(jié)構(gòu) 6.6 公式節(jié)點(diǎn) 6.7 結(jié)構(gòu)連線中的一些常見問題 6.8 搭積木:脈寬調(diào)制 6.9 課后閱讀:使用LabVIEW研究全球變暖現(xiàn)象 6.10 小結(jié)第7章 數(shù)組和簇 7.1 數(shù)組 7.2 用循環(huán)創(chuàng)建數(shù)組 7.3 數(shù)組函數(shù) 7.4 多態(tài)性 ……第8章 圖標(biāo)和圖形第9章 數(shù)據(jù)采集第10章 字符串和文件第11章 分析附錄
章節(jié)摘錄
第1章 LabVlEW入門 1.3 LabVIEW環(huán)境 LabVIEW是Laboratory Virtual Instrument Engineering Workbench(實(shí)驗(yàn)室虛擬儀器集成環(huán)境)的簡稱,是由美國國家儀器公司(National Instruments,NI)創(chuàng)立的一個(gè)功能強(qiáng)大而又靈活的圖形開發(fā)環(huán)境。Nl公司生產(chǎn)基于計(jì)算機(jī)技術(shù)的軟硬件產(chǎn)品,其產(chǎn)品幫助工程師和科學(xué)家進(jìn)行測量、過程控制及數(shù)據(jù)分析和存儲。Nl公司在將近30年前由James Truchard,Jeffrey Kodosky和Bill Nowlin創(chuàng)建于得克薩斯州的奧斯汀分校。3X當(dāng)時(shí)正在位于得克薩斯大學(xué)奧斯汀分校的應(yīng)用研究實(shí)驗(yàn)室為美國海軍進(jìn)行聲吶應(yīng)用研究,尋找將測試設(shè)備連接到DEC PDP-11計(jì)算機(jī)的方法。James Truchard決定開發(fā)一種接口總線,并吸納Jeff和Bill共同研究,終于成功地開發(fā)出LabVIEW并提出了“虛擬儀器”這一概念。在此過程中,他們創(chuàng)立了一家新公司——National Instruments。 從事研究、開發(fā)、生產(chǎn)、測試工作,以及在諸如汽車、半導(dǎo)體、電子、化學(xué)、電信、制藥等行業(yè)工作的工程師和科學(xué)家已經(jīng)使用并一直使用LabVIEw來完成他們的工作0LabVIEW在試驗(yàn)測量、工業(yè)自動(dòng)化和數(shù)據(jù)分析領(lǐng)域起著重要作用。例如,在NASA(美國國家航空和宇宙航行局)的噴氣推進(jìn)實(shí)驗(yàn)室,科學(xué)家們開始用LabVlEW來分析和顯示“火星探險(xiǎn)旅行者號”自行裝置的工程數(shù)據(jù),包括自行裝置的位置和溫度、電池剩余電量,并總體監(jiān)測旅行者號的全面可用狀態(tài)。本書的意圖是幫助讀者學(xué)習(xí)使用LabVIEW編程工具,作為培養(yǎng)讀者圖形化編程能力和了解大量可使用的應(yīng)用程序的入門課程?! abVIEW程序稱為“虛擬儀器”或簡稱為Vl。LabVIEW不同于基于文本的編程語言(如FortraIl和C),而是一種圖形編程語言——通常稱為G編程語言,其編程過程就是通過圖形符號描述程序的行為。LabVIEW使用的是科學(xué)家和工程師們所熟悉的術(shù)語,還使用了易于識別的構(gòu)造G語言的圖形符號。即使只具有很少編程經(jīng)驗(yàn)的人也能學(xué)會(huì)使用LabVIEW,并能夠發(fā)現(xiàn)和了解一些有用的基本編程原則。如果以前從未編寫過程序(或許有過一些編程經(jīng)驗(yàn)但已忘了許多),在鉆研G編程語言之前,則需要復(fù)習(xí)一下編程方面的基本概念。 LabVIEW提供了大量虛擬儀器和函數(shù)庫來幫助編程。LabVIEW 89提出了一個(gè)新的重要功能,稱為MathScript環(huán)境,將在第3章詳細(xì)討論。
編輯推薦
可作為大、中專院校通信、測控等相關(guān)專業(yè)的教材或教學(xué)參考書,也可作為相關(guān)工程技術(shù)人員設(shè)計(jì)開發(fā)儀器或自動(dòng)測試系統(tǒng)的技術(shù)參考書?! 〕汕先f的工程師、科學(xué)家和技術(shù)人員都在使用LabVIEW來創(chuàng)建應(yīng)用程序所需要的解決方案。LabVIEW是一種革命性的圖形編程開發(fā)環(huán)境,以G編程語言為基礎(chǔ),用于數(shù)據(jù)采集、控制、數(shù)據(jù)分析以及數(shù)據(jù)顯示。
圖書封面
圖書標(biāo)簽Tags
無
評論、評分、閱讀與下載